“Petrodvoretsky, Oktyabrsky, Primorsky, Leninsky, Krasnogvardeisky, Kuibyshevsky, Sestroretsky, Dzerzhinsky, Vasileostrovsky district courts are evacuated,” the joint press service of the city’s courts said in a statement.

It is specified that at the moment the Leninsky and Krasnogvardeisky courts have returned to work.

Earlier in St. Petersburg, two district courts received emails with threats of mining and a request to transfer 120 bitcoins.
